.book-card-link[data-astro-cid-h7d7dyl7]{display:block;width:100%;max-width:none;text-decoration:none;color:inherit;transition:transform .15s ease}.book-card-link[data-astro-cid-h7d7dyl7]:hover,.book-card-link[data-astro-cid-h7d7dyl7]:focus-visible{transform:translateY(-2px)}.indie-protection-heading[data-astro-cid-h7d7dyl7]{display:inline-flex;align-items:center;gap:12px;scroll-margin-top:120px}.indie-protection-heading[data-astro-cid-h7d7dyl7] .section-icon{width:48px;height:48px;flex-shrink:0}.book-card[data-astro-cid-h7d7dyl7]{display:flex;flex-direction:row;gap:18px;align-items:center;padding:18px 20px;min-height:0;width:100%;box-sizing:border-box}.book-cover-placeholder[data-astro-cid-h7d7dyl7]{width:84px;height:126px;border-radius:2px;background:linear-gradient(135deg,#e9eef3,#d8e1ea);background-size:cover;background-position:center;background-repeat:no-repeat;flex-shrink:0;box-shadow:0 3px 10px #0d1c2d1f}.book-card-text[data-astro-cid-h7d7dyl7]{display:grid;gap:6px;min-width:0;text-align:left}.book-card[data-astro-cid-h7d7dyl7] h3[data-astro-cid-h7d7dyl7]{color:var(--link);font-size:clamp(16px,1.25vw,20px);line-height:1.12;font-family:var(--font-display);letter-spacing:-.02em;overflow-wrap:anywhere}.book-card-text[data-astro-cid-h7d7dyl7]>p[data-astro-cid-h7d7dyl7]{margin:0;font-size:clamp(13px,1.05vw,16px);line-height:1.3;color:var(--text)}.book-card-protected[data-astro-cid-h7d7dyl7]{display:inline-flex;align-items:center;gap:10px;margin-top:8px;color:color-mix(in srgb,var(--text) 72%,white 28%);font-size:14px;line-height:1.25;max-width:100%}.book-card-protected[data-astro-cid-h7d7dyl7] span[data-astro-cid-h7d7dyl7]{min-width:0;overflow-wrap:anywhere}.book-card-protected[data-astro-cid-h7d7dyl7] img[data-astro-cid-h7d7dyl7]{width:18px;height:18px;flex-shrink:0}.home-thanks-note[data-astro-cid-h7d7dyl7]{color:var(--text)!important}.home-full-width-copy[data-astro-cid-h7d7dyl7],.home-indie-section[data-astro-cid-h7d7dyl7] p[data-astro-cid-h7d7dyl7]{max-width:none!important}@media(max-width:640px){.book-card[data-astro-cid-h7d7dyl7]{gap:14px;padding:16px}.book-cover-placeholder[data-astro-cid-h7d7dyl7]{width:72px;height:108px}.book-card[data-astro-cid-h7d7dyl7] h3[data-astro-cid-h7d7dyl7]{font-size:clamp(16px,6vw,20px)}}.authors-hero[data-astro-cid-binbzjnn]{display:grid;grid-template-columns:minmax(0,3fr) minmax(0,2fr);column-gap:32px;row-gap:16px;align-items:center;padding-bottom:28px}.authors-hero[data-astro-cid-binbzjnn]>[data-astro-cid-binbzjnn]{min-width:0}.authors-hero-title[data-astro-cid-binbzjnn]{font-size:clamp(36px,5vw,56px);line-height:1.1;margin-bottom:0}.authors-hero-lede[data-astro-cid-binbzjnn]{color:var(--link)!important;font-size:22.95px!important;line-height:1.45!important;margin:0}.authors-hero-body[data-astro-cid-binbzjnn]{color:var(--text);font-size:22.95px;line-height:1.45;margin:0}.authors-hero-copy[data-astro-cid-binbzjnn]{grid-column:1;grid-row:1;display:flex;flex-direction:column;gap:var(--section-flow-gap)}.authors-hero-image[data-astro-cid-binbzjnn]{grid-column:2;grid-row:1 / span 2;margin-left:auto;margin-right:0}.authors-hero-actions[data-astro-cid-binbzjnn]{grid-column:1;grid-row:2;justify-content:flex-start}.author-amazon-commerce-section[data-astro-cid-binbzjnn]{padding-top:28px!important}.author-commerce-grid{grid-template-columns:repeat(2,minmax(min(100%,280px),1fr))!important;justify-content:stretch!important;width:100%!important;max-width:none!important;margin-left:0!important;margin-right:0!important}.author-commerce-grid>.card{width:100%!important;max-width:none!important}.author-commerce-grid .card h2{color:var(--text)}.author-contrast-note[data-astro-cid-binbzjnn]{color:var(--accent)}.author-contrast-note-plain[data-astro-cid-binbzjnn]{display:block;color:var(--text)!important;font-size:16px;font-weight:400;line-height:1.35;margin-top:8px}.author-epub-note[data-astro-cid-binbzjnn]{color:var(--accent)}.author-security-note[data-astro-cid-binbzjnn]{color:var(--text)!important;font-size:16px!important;line-height:1.25!important}.author-save-highlight[data-astro-cid-binbzjnn]{display:inline-block;font-weight:900;font-size:1.35em;line-height:1;vertical-align:baseline}.author-icon-card[data-astro-cid-binbzjnn]{align-items:flex-start;width:100%}.author-icon-card[data-astro-cid-binbzjnn] .icon-grid-card-copy[data-astro-cid-binbzjnn]{min-width:0}@media(max-width:900px){.author-icon-card[data-astro-cid-binbzjnn]{align-items:stretch;text-align:left}}.author-publish-cta[data-astro-cid-binbzjnn]{width:100%;max-width:none;padding:29px 32px!important}.author-publish-cta-row[data-astro-cid-binbzjnn]{justify-content:center!important;width:100%}.author-protection-button[data-astro-cid-binbzjnn]{display:inline-flex!important;align-items:center;justify-content:center;gap:10px}.author-protection-button-label[data-astro-cid-binbzjnn]{display:inline-block;font-size:14px;font-weight:600;line-height:1}.author-protection-icon[data-astro-cid-binbzjnn]{display:inline-flex;align-items:center;justify-content:center;width:28px;height:28px;flex-shrink:0}.author-protection-icon[data-astro-cid-binbzjnn] .section-icon{width:100%;height:100%;display:block}@media(orientation:portrait){.authors-hero-lede[data-astro-cid-binbzjnn],.authors-hero-body[data-astro-cid-binbzjnn]{font-size:18.36px!important;line-height:1.45!important}.authors-hero[data-astro-cid-binbzjnn]{grid-template-columns:1fr;align-items:center;justify-items:center;text-align:center}.authors-hero-copy[data-astro-cid-binbzjnn]{text-align:center;align-items:center}.authors-hero-copy[data-astro-cid-binbzjnn],.authors-hero-image[data-astro-cid-binbzjnn],.authors-hero-actions[data-astro-cid-binbzjnn]{grid-column:1}.authors-hero-copy[data-astro-cid-binbzjnn]{grid-row:1}.authors-hero-image[data-astro-cid-binbzjnn]{grid-row:2;margin-left:auto;margin-right:auto}.authors-hero-actions[data-astro-cid-binbzjnn]{grid-row:3;justify-content:center}}@media(max-width:1200px){.author-commerce-grid{grid-template-columns:repeat(2,minmax(0,1fr))!important}}@media(max-width:900px){.author-commerce-grid{grid-template-columns:1fr!important}}@media(orientation:landscape)and (max-width:900px){.authors-hero[data-astro-cid-binbzjnn]{grid-template-columns:minmax(0,1.2fr) minmax(0,.8fr);column-gap:20px;padding-bottom:16px}.authors-hero-title[data-astro-cid-binbzjnn]{font-size:clamp(28px,4.5vw,42px)}.authors-hero-lede[data-astro-cid-binbzjnn],.authors-hero-body[data-astro-cid-binbzjnn]{font-size:15.3px!important;line-height:1.35!important}.authors-hero-image[data-astro-cid-binbzjnn]{max-width:100%!important}}@media(max-width:400px){.authors-hero-lede[data-astro-cid-binbzjnn],.authors-hero-body[data-astro-cid-binbzjnn]{font-size:16.15px!important}}
